Cross-chain Interoperability: The Key to a More Integrated Blockchain Future

In the ever-evolving landscape of blockchain technology, cross-chain interoperability has emerged as a pivotal concept for fostering a more integrated and cohesive digital economy. As various blockchain platforms develop unique features and capabilities, the need for seamless communication and interaction between these distinct systems has never been more critical.

Cross-chain interoperability refers to the ability of different blockchain networks to share data and functionalities. This capability enables users to transfer assets and information across various blockchains without the need for centralized intermediaries. By bridging the gap between disparate networks, interoperability enhances the overall efficiency and usability of blockchain technology.

One of the key benefits of cross-chain interoperability is the increase in liquidity for digital assets. When different blockchains can interact with one another, users can easily transfer tokens from one network to another, unlocking value and facilitating more dynamic trading opportunities. This can lead to reduced volatility and improved market efficiency as assets can flow more freely between ecosystems.

Moreover, cross-chain protocols serve to enhance the capabilities of decentralized applications (dApps). Developers can leverage the strengths of various blockchains, integrating sophisticated features that would not be possible on a single platform. For instance, a dApp could utilize Ethereum's robust smart contract functionalities while simultaneously tapping into the speed and lower transaction costs of a network like Binance Smart Chain. This synergy fosters innovation and fosters the development of more complex and user-friendly decentralized solutions.

Security is another critical aspect where interoperability comes into play. By facilitating communication between various blockchain platforms, cross-chain solutions can enhance security protocols. For example, using shared or pooled security mechanisms can protect transactions across multiple networks, thereby minimizing risks associated with single points of failure. This layered security approach can bolster user confidence and encourage greater participation in decentralized platforms.

Several projects are actively working to develop and enhance cross-chain interoperability. Platforms like Polkadot and Cosmos utilize unique architectures designed to connect disparate blockchains. By creating an ecosystem that allows various chains to communicate, these platforms promise enhanced scalability and improved functionality, positioning themselves at the forefront of Decentralized Finance (DeFi) and other blockchain advancements.

However, the journey towards widespread cross-chain interoperability is not without challenges. Issues such as governance complexities, varying consensus mechanisms, and differing security protocols can complicate the integration process. For successful integration, stakeholders need to collaborate, establish standards, and create a framework that addresses these complexities while ensuring user security and data integrity.
